Pennsylvania Auto Loan Debt Laws

Everything you need to know about auto loan debt in Pennsylvania: SOL is 4 years, garnishment capped at no wage garnishment for most debts, and 3 state-specific protections apply.

How to Dispute Auto Loan Debt in Pennsylvania

1
Challenge deficiency balance after repossession
2
Verify the sale was commercially reasonable (UCC requirement)
3
Dispute if proper repossession notice wasn't given
4
Check for state-specific redemption rights
5
Validate any collection attempts under FDCPA

Pennsylvania Consumer Protections

NO wage garnishment for most consumer debts
Short 4-year SOL
Treble damages under UTPCPL

Auto Loan Debt Tips for Pennsylvania Residents

Lenders must sell repossessed vehicles at commercially reasonable price
Many states require advance notice before repossession
Deficiency balance collectors must validate under FDCPA
